What You Will Do In Your Role
- Lead negotiations on contract terms, payment structures, and reimbursement with other parties addressing potential disputes and mitigating risks
- Develop trusted supplier and client relationships
- Apply sound economic thinking to the achievement of goals and objectives
- Apply best practices to contracting and sourcing events
- Engage subject-matter experts’ input in a timely manner as part of the contract negotiations
- Analyze and redline contract clauses, stipulations, obligations, and liabilities
